Pre-Trip Preparation
Before you head to the airport it is important to have:
Verified Identification in the form of a passport or the correct domestic identification.
Correct Travel Documents: A copy of the ticket on your phone, a physical copy if you are not using self checkin, the correct visas if traveling where there are restrictions
Medical Checkup if Needed: Have shot records with you if certain shots are needed for travel to a country where it is needed. Check with the embassy before travel to ensure you have the correct medical information.
Check-In for your Flight and have your boarding pass on your phone. Double check you have your flight details available and with your passport and any other identification you may need.

Do not take in your person or carryon
- Over-Sized Liquids: Any liquid, gels, shampoos, conditioners that do not fit in your clear plastic bag which totals (100ml) Commonly confiscated items: Large tubes of toothpaste, full-size perfume, Food jars and water.
Sharp Objects: * Knives: Even small pocket knives or Swiss Army knives. Scissors: Only permitted if the blades are shorter than 4 inches from the pivot point in a nail kit.
Self-Defense Items: * Pepper Spray/Mace: Strictly prohibited in the cabin.
Heavy Tools: Items like hammers or screwdrivers longer than 7 inches.
Flammables:
Lighters and Aerosols including hair spray.
